Module #1 Basic Medical Terminology

Prefix/Suffix/Medical Term

    Question list

  • 1

    a/an-

    Without

  • 2

    -algesia

    Pain

  • 3

    Contra-

    Against

  • 4

    -megaly

    Enlargement

  • 5

    Letters or syllables added to the beginning of a word root to alter its meaning.

    Prefixes

  • 6

    This usually indicates direction, number, position, size, presence or absence, or time.

    Prefixes

  • 7

    These are letters or syllables added to the end of a word root to alter its meaning.

    Suffixes

  • 8

    In medical terminology, these often indicate a condition or a type of procedure.

    Suffixes

  • 9

    These are the main part of a word and may be combined with prefixes, suffixes, or other roots.

    Word roots

  • 10

    This is used to facilitate pronunciation when the word root is combined with another word root or suffix that does not begin with a vowel.

    Combining form

  • 11

    Combining form of a word toot contains a vowel, usually an “_”

    o

  • 12

    In writing and using medical terms, it is important to know that vatious medical terms have different ______.

    Plural forms

  • 13

    Plural form of Vertabra

    Vertabrae

  • 14

    Singular form of Thoraces

    Thorax

  • 15

    Plural form of Foramen

    Foramina

  • 16

    Singular form of Apices

    Apex

  • 17

    Plural form of Diagnosis

    Diagnoses

  • 18

    Singular form of Sarcomata

    Sarcoma

  • 19

    Plural form of Plalanx

    Phalanges

  • 20

    Singular form of Ganglia

    Ganglion

  • 21

    Singular form of Bacteria

    Bacterium

  • 22

    Singular form of Alveoli

    Alveolus

  • 23

    Plural form of Biopsy

    Biopsies

  • 24

    True or False ie and ue, only the second vowel is pronounced.

    False

  • 25

    True or False c and g are given the soft sound of s and j, before e, i, and y.

    True

  • 26

    True or False ps is pronounced like s

    True

  • 27

    True or False pn in the middle of a word is pronounced with a soft p and a soft n.

    False

  • 28

    True or False pn in the beginning of a word is pronounced with only the n sound.

    True

  • 29

    EDTA

    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id
